Рекомендуется: анализ, как фильтровать нецивилизованные символы % Function badchar (str) badstr = нецивилизованный список символов, отдельный с | (Поскольку персонажи не могут быть сдержаны при публикации, его нельзя опубликовать.) Badword = split (badstr, |) для i = 0 до ubound (badword), если instr (str, badword (i)) 0, то Badchar = true exit для else badchar = false end, если следующий
ASP делает голосование в программе DIG (некоторые называются сверху и наступают). Поскольку код длинный, публикуется только основная часть: код в голосовании
На странице показано голосование:
<div class = hogle1> <script src = '/voltersult.asp? id = 1 & action = view'> </script> </div>
Эффект, как показано на рисунке: затем нажмите, чтобы проголосовать, и количество голосов увеличится на 1, как показано на рисунке:
vorkerSult.asp код
<%
Response.contenttype = text/html; charset = gb2312
«Автор: Wuqing Source: Пожалуйста, сохраните источник при перепечатку
'Код базы данных ссылок опущено
Установить rs = server.createObject (adodb.recordset)
SQL = (выберите News_ID, проголосовать из dwww_news, где news_id = & request (id) &)
Rs.open SQL, Conn, 1,1
Если не rs.eof, а не rs.bof, то сначала проверьте, верен ли идентификатор
Если запрос (action) = view, то, если это идентификатор из кода новостного кода
Если instr (request.cookies (gothid), запрос (id) и |) <> 0, то судите, проголосовали ли новости об удостоверении личности.
response.write document.write (<div class = 'result' id = 'result_ & rs (news_id) &'> & rs (голосование) и </div>);
response.write document.write (<span class = 'result_link' id = 'result_link_ & rs (news_id) &'> голосование успешно </span>);
еще
response.write document.write (<div class = 'result' id = 'result_ & rs (news_id) &'> <a href = 'javascript: dovote (& requer (id) &)'> & rs (hoge) & </a> </div>);
response.write document.write (<span class = 'result_link' id = 'result_link_ & rs (news_id) &'> <a href = 'javascript: dovote (& requent (id) &)'> голосование </a> </span>);
конец, если
Иначе нажмите, чтобы проголосовать, чтобы обработать код
Если instr (request.cokies (goatid), запрос (id) и |) <> 0 then
Response.cookies (gothid) = запрос (id) & |
Response.cookies (hogeId) .expires = date ()+365
еще
Response.cookies (hogeId) = запрос (id) и | & request.cookies (goatide)
Response.cookies (hogeId) .expires = date ()+365
конец, если
Поделиться: ASP вызывает пример библиотеки Pure IP % '==================================================================================================== ===================================================================== =
3 страницы в общей сложности предыдущей страницы 123 Следующая страница